Thinking About Rivian’s Darkout Package? Here’s Why You Should Add It at Checkout

Ryan from The Kilowatts recently reached out to Rivian to see how much it would cost to add the Darkout Package to his Gen 2 R1Safter delivery. For reference, the Darkout Package, which includes Gunmetal skid plates and Black badging, is a $750 option when selected at the time of purchase. Retrofitting it later, however, isn’t so budget-friendly. Rivian’s quote revealed a total cost of $2,381, broken down into parts…
